Description
SJ 97 SE MACCLESFIELD FOREST C.P. ANKERS LANE (North Side)
5/90 Milestone 210m, north-west of Torgate Farm.
II
Milestone: c1750. Triangular sectioned ashlar sandstone block with a shaped head. Inscriptions becoming illegible through exfoliation and probable deliberate erasure but east face can still be read as "To Macclesfield 5 miles" and west face "To London 165 miles".
One of a group of milestones on the old Macclesfield-Buxton turnpike of 1750. There are 2 others in Macclesfield Forest (q.v.). The stones were probably erased when the new turnpike was built in 1821.
